Personality:
Born as a cursed child, Hiei led a path of loneliness and power, seeking every way to it He would flaunt his precious stone to draw enemies and then kill them.

At first glance he is seen as a rather cruel and heartless murderer who could care less about others and more about himself. His trust for demons and humans alike was nonexistence. Hiei trusted a group of bandits in the past, seeing them as almost family, but they shunned him because they feared him. After that event, Hiei had a hard time trusting others. There was a loathing darkness in his heart for a long time. During times when no demons dare approached him because of his immense power Hiei allowed himself to indulge in what little happiness was offered by his mother's tear stone that was given to him when he was still a baby. The stone gave him a sense of peacefulness, calmness as if it took all his pains and sorrows away. He valued it very much, but these notions were hidden when he was with others. Emotions made him weak, thus he severed them.

When he lost the stone, he realized how important it was to him, hence sacrificing his power for a Jagan, because the pain he endured was nothing compared to losing the only link he had to his mother and supposed younger sister. He endlessly searched for it for a long time before he realized he need another type of power to get his stone back. He sought out the demon surgeon Shigure. Shigure forced Hiei to tell him something that would be worth his interest in order for Hiei obtain the Jagan. The only time Hiei told his life story, was to Shigure. Hence, Shigure finding interest in that with the only rule that aside finding his stone, he was also unable to tell his sister that they were related. Hiei was fine with that, because he already chose not to tell her to begin with.

The process was almost unbearable. The pain was beyond comprehension and due to the surgery, Hiei had lost all the power that he had obtained. With that, he recovered and wanted to leave, but Shigure had stopped him and taught him a few things to survive the world with the sword. It is unclear to how Hiei feels about Shigure but he owed the man for giving him the Jagan and teaching him swordsmanship in which he adapted and turned into his own. Perhaps, there was some respect for this man named Shigure that Hiei had learned from. Hiei's personality did not change much during this time. He remained the same, distant and cold demon, and finally finding the island of the ice apparitions (Koorime) but he did not kill them because he felt they were already dead, frozen as the land they lived in.

He didn't seek revenge for his mother, nor did he kill Rui. He simply knew that the people here were set for destruction, thus he left without caring about destroying the ice apparitions and the world they lived in. His search led to human world in which he quickly acted, engaging in a fight with the younger Kurama. After being injured and taken care of by the former thief, he wanted to do something else. He along with Kurama and Gouki, raided the Reikai vault for the three items of darkness. It was shown more of how he was distrustful of others and how betrayed he felt when Kurama turned on him, but because he knew that Kurama was dangerous, he did not engage with the fox demon. Betrayal was something he would not easily forget, especially when Kurama also got in his way when he was trying to kill off Yuusuke. Kurama handicapped Hiei for the time being and despite all that, Hiei had shown throughout the series that he had a lot of trust and respect towards Kurama, regardless of what had already happened.

After his raid of the Reikai vault and ending up as a lackey for Reikai. Hiei went through a rather slow yet progressive change in himself. His ambitions were not simply just for power or to be the strongest demon around. It still was a goal that he wanted to pursue power, but he developed a sense of humanity that he never had before. Despite his constant coldness and rudeness towards his companions he actually does care about them more than he lets on. It was shown that after leaving the group during the Sensui Arc, Hiei returned to assist Yuusuke when Sniper attempted to kill Yuusuke using his territory. Hiei managed to avoid killing Sniper and fighting Yuusuke in which led him to follow Yuusuke back and rejoining his companions in the fight to save humanity. He slowly and gradually opened his eyes to the human race by learning about humans. Hiei only acknowledged them but had not accepted them completely. His distaste for the human race slowly dispersed as he spent long days in the Ningenkai. He would rather keep to himself than talk to others.

He often made it a habit to insult people. Most people were targets to his snark comments, such as Kuwabara. Kuwabara always got angry with Hiei for insulting him Hiei saw him as an easy target of the crew, so he liked to poke at Kuwabara's nerves for his own amusement. His relationship to Kuwabara didn't seem to be such a great one but Kuwabara was an invaluable ally that he would never admit, but would protect just as he and Kuwabara, and Kurama tried to kill Sensui knowing they were no match for the overpowered Sensui. Hiei was willing to kill Sensui because he had killed Yuusuke. This proved how valuable Hiei's allies/friends are to him, even if he frequently hid it. Hiei just like Kurama, Kuwabara and Yuusuke would sacrifice himself for his companions and there was no denying that he would conveniently show up when he was needed.

It is obvious that he also values family. Despite his neutral reactions towards his twin, Hiei actually spent a large amount time watching and protecting her as well as lowering his violence levels when he's around her. When anyone did threaten his only family, he would definitely not give a second thought before killing the person. He's extremely protective as it is clear. He might treat her with a cold shoulder sometimes, but he did it for her own good. He didn't believe that she would accept him even though she probably would have. After all the girl desperately searched for her only brother day in and day out. As many times as he said he does not care for the Ningenkai, he saved it just as many times. He often never admitted to caring, but secretly he does. Hiei would only do things that would benefit himself. Most of the time it would mean that he was getting something in return like halving a sentence or some form of power. He doesn't make it a habit to save people and only does it when he has no other choice.

He's rather blunt with everything. He didn't sugar coat his words when he spoke. and often said things as they were told. If the enemy was weak they're weak if they're strong they're strong. People with interesting abilities intrigue him and he might use that as a reason for even speaking to these people in general. Underneath all that tough skin he's pretty much a huge sap regarding people he has been close to or spent most of his time with his companions. At one point during the Three Kings Saga, Hiei came to a conclusion that he had nothing left to live for that there was nothing else he could do with his life, so he would gladly give it up. Though, have his abrupt resurrection thanks to Mukuro, Hiei has aimed to do something different in the end, but one day he did aim to win the Makai Tournament and be king of all demons.

He wasn't that much different from his companions. The thing he shared with his companions was a bond and an understanding that couldn't easily be severed. He likes a good fight, and he fights fairly. He didn't use cheap tricks, at least not after Yuusuke pawned him. Hiei also disliked doing things that were beneath him. He has his own pride to conserve. Hiei was a proud demon despite his disposition. He didn't cheat his way to a win and gained his own right and name through his own abilities. He had sacrificed so much to gain so little, yet he seemed to be quite content with himself. Hiei learned a lot of things during his journey, like morals, and codes of honors, almost similar to Kuwabara,'s but much more basic. He never liked people telling him what to do, or people telling him to kill them. Hiei followed no one's orders and he seemed to show that much during the series. There had to be some sort of bargaining chip for him most of the time for him to agree on anything.

Abilities/Powers:
Demon Speed: Being a demon, Hiei move faster than the human eye and even faster than most demon eyes. His speed is truly remarkable and allows him to create teleporting movements with his speed as well as brief projections of himself to confuse the opponent. He moves so fast that it takes a lot of time and perception for one to be able to pierce him, hence taking longer than it should to scratch him in battle. His speed also adds to the deadliness of his swordsmanship.

Demon Strength: Hiei is considered a S Class demon, the highest class that demons and humans could achieve. It is said that S Classes are strong that their strength could annihilate a large area. They are rare types of demons that even Spirit World was unaware of them. It is also mentioned that A Classes have a hard time achieving this level. It’s a rare level of power that only a handful of demons possess. This also means when Hiei releases his full demonic strength and powers, he could level a large portion of property. With that being said, his supernatural abilities are achieved by hard work and strong will.

Immunity: Obviously being half Hi Youkai, Hiei is immune to fire. He quickly absorbs it as it is thrown at him which is the same for both cases with Zeru and his Koukuryuuha. Hiei is a true flame master even if he is a half breed. So to speak, he is immune to fire. He is also part Koorime, giving him the immunity to ice. Even though he does not use ice powers, and never proven canonly that he had any, but Hiei did not freeze to death when Seiryuu tried to freeze him with his ice. It had little or no effect on Hiei as a being whereas it completely got Byakko without a second glance. It is the luck that he is half and half that he was able to withstand a lot before he could be turned to ice or burned to a crisp.

Sword Play: It is his most prized skill and his most used skills. Despite being able to fight with his fists and feet, he is even deadlier when using his sword. Hiei has swung a sword since he was a young toddler, and saw nothing but bloodbaths on his paths. His swordsmanship increased tenfold after his Jagan implant and some tips from the Youkai Surgeon, Shigure. Hiei's sword movements are as fast as his speed. Normal humans cannot see these lightning fast movements and it goes the same for lower level demons. These swift attacks are deadly alone and used multiple times can clearly end an enemy's life. His skills are so great with his sword, he is also able to pierce through flesh of others, and damage not internal organs for example: Hagiri, Kaname (Sniper). The Doctor Kamiya specifically said: "It completely missed every vital organ and muscle. I wouldn't say the sword 'stabbed' you, it really just slipped through. I've treated hundreds of people but I've never seen anything like it." Hiei's swordsmanship is one of a kind. Hiei can create as many as sixteen slashes during his movements. It would have increased dramatically since his fight with Seiryuu.

The Jagan Eye (邪眼): Hiei also has an implanted eye called the Jagan on his forehead. It is also known as the Evil Eye.
  • It was implanted in him when he was searching for his lost Hiruiseki stone and the Hyouga tribe, that tossed him over the cliff, hence it's tracking abilities.
  • The Jagan allows him to manipulate Level E humans and Level E demons, and demons and humans with very little or no spiritual abilities.
  • He can use them to his advantages as well as read open minds unless there is a mental barrier or an unknown source of power to prevent him from doing so otherwise.
  • The Jagan is often used to lure and assist in summoning the Dragons.
  • Telekinesis is also something he is capable of at certain times. That also includes binding people. It was obvious when Yuusuke tried to overtake Hiei and he used his Jagan's binding abilities to make sure Yuusuke was trapped and unmovable.
  • Telepathy is common for those with the Jagan as well.
  • He can also tamper with memories like hypnosis. It was showed in the last few chapters of the manga when he specifically Jagan eyed a human and fixed his memories and sent him.


Jao Ensatsu Rengoku Shou (邪王炎殺煉獄焦): Or The Blaze-Murdering Purgatory Scorch (Fist of the Mortal Flame in the Anime), a move that summons the lesser 'mundane,' flame of the Ningenkai into one or both of his fists added with his inhuman speed it creates a very faster and unbelievable close range attack that could strike multiple times. The damage isn't as powerful as the others but it will suffice for simple things like destroying solid weapons or punching out giant cement blocks. It works on most demons of any classes really unless they were like Hiei, immune to fire. Another branch off of this attack is a Flamethrower. He has only used this against Bui and it was proven ineffective but it creates a range attack spiraling. A nice view though.

Jao Ensatsu Ken (邪王炎殺剣): Or The Tyrant King's Blaze-Murdering Sword (Sword of the Darkness Flame in the Anime) an attack that he lures the dark flames of Reikai using his demon energy again and channels it into his sword instead of releasing them completely, making it quite dangerous for the smaller youkai and his body. He has a bit of distaste for this attack because of its close relation to Kuwabara's Rei Ken. Though, as time passes, he is able to manifest the energy into a sword like Kuwabara, but there are differences in Kuwabara's Rei Ken and Hiei's Jao Ensatsu Ken. He used this attack a few times and one time he used it once with his sword as an amplifier and the second time against the opponent he managed to create a sword purely from the Darkness Flame.

Jao Ensatsu Koukuryuuha (邪王炎殺黒龍波): Or The Tyrant King's Blaze-Murdering Black Dragon Wave (Dragon of the Darkness Flame in the Anime): It involves Hiei creating a fire dragon from the Makai using his energy as a lure the flames to him and released in the direction of his target or enemy. The dragon at first cannot be controlled directly once released. As the series continues, he is able to summon the dragon without burning his arm and through the events prior to the Makai Tournament; Hiei was seen to be able to summon multiple dragons to defeat the enemy. This summon is only one after the other.

The Jao Ensatsu Koukuryuuha is known to be one of the strongest attacks in the Yu Yu Hakusho World.

Jao Ensatsu Koukuryuuha (consumption/absorption): It is also considered a very powerful attack, only it isn't used on the enemy but the user. Hiei has done something that no other masters of the Jao Ensatsu Technique tried. He consumed the Koukuryuuha into his body, he becomes the Koukuryuuha and that allows him a moment of power. It allows him to use the power to its peak giving him a moment of limited invincibility. It also raises his defenses greatly and giving him a boost of leaping rather high in the air resembling a 'Rising Dragon.' As well as he could shoot flames from his hands and engulf himself in flames to jump high in the air. Though as powerful as it is, the consumption of the Koukuryuuha drains his youki relentlessly and Hiei must hibernate in order to regain his youki back.

Jao Ensatsu Koukuryuuha (Jaganshi Form): This is a Movie Exclusive ability. It allows Hiei to release multiple dragons all at once instead of the usual one. Though, a period of hibernation is required after all that. It drains a lot of energy apparently. The technique in this form was never stated to be mastered or not so we're going to be left in the dark. I'm going to say that it does get mastered because of the point and time I am taking this character from. Feel free to critique me if I am wrong. He only used it once and never again during the second movie. It was against the Netherworld God Raigo. It is considered his most powerful attack.

Jaganshi Form (邪眼師) aka Evil Eye Practitioner: This is a body transformation that turns his skin green and allows rather morbid looking eyes to sprout from every part of his body. It's a rather repulsive appearance. The Jagan at that time will be given more power as well. It's much stronger and more effective than ever. It enhances his usual super human speed, which allows him to blind his enemies with a curse. It allows him to summon multiple dragons at once than the usual one after the other. It's considered a power up most of the time and most likely a form he only took only twice once during the series and once more during the second movie. Hiei relies on his Jao Ensatsu Koukuryuuha technique more often than this one so it is often forgotten.

Astral Projection: This is a manga exclusive technique that Hiei can separate his physical body and his spirit.

Others: He also has the ability to mask his own youki that allows him to not be found by any one of his companions or anyone in particular unless he wants to be found. Even tracking devices, he could confuse with his own energy and lead people off.
